David Fincher May Direct A Facebook Movie

David Fincher was a movie director for Fight Club, Se7en, and Panic Room.  Now he is being considered to direct a movie that revolves around the growth of Facebook and the life of Mark Zuckerberg.  The working title of the movie is called “The Social Network” and Columbia Pictures is in advanced talks with Fincher.

The movie will start with Zuckerberg’s creation of the social network while at Harvard University back in 2004 to the point where it has over 200 million users today.

Scott Rudin and Michael De Luca would be the producers. Kevin Spacey and Dana Brunetti may also be involved.  The author of the script is Aaron Sorkin.  Columbia hopes to begin production later this year.  Another rumor about the movie is that Michael Cera and Shia LaBeouf are being looked at to play the role of Mark Zuckerberg.
